Roma and Lecce sent Julio Sergio their ‘deepest condolences’ as their former goalkeeper’s son Enzo tragically died at the age of 15 on Sunday.
Roma and Lecce mourn the death of Enzo Bertagnoli, son of their former goalkeeper Julio Sergio.
Roma and Lecce send condolences to Julio Sergio

“Julio, we stand with you during this period of unimaginable sorrow,” the Giallorossi wrote on X, formerly Twitter.
“The whole of AS Roma is with your family, and we send you our deepest condolences.”
Lecce wrote: “US Lecce express our condolences for the passing of Enzo Bertagnoli, son of our former goalkeeper Julio Sergio.”
Julio Sergio’s son Enzo had been diagnosed with brain cancer in 2020, and the ex-Roma goalkeeper confirmed his tragic death via social media on Sunday.
Julio Sergio had recently shaved his head to show support for his son during chemotherapy.

Julio Sergio played 58 Serie A matches with Lecce and Roma, keeping 20 clean sheets.
He spent several years in Italy, from 2006 to 2013, winning two Coppa Italia and one Supercoppa with Roma. Julio Sergio also made three appearances in the Champions League and five in the Europa League during his time at the Stadio Olimpico.
The former Brazilian goalkeeper spent the rest of his career in his native country, playing for Santos, Comercial SP, Juventude, and Botafogo. Julio Sergio, now 46, retired in 2014.
